According to Svmuu, market rumors suggest that complaints about vehicle battery locking triggered regulatory attention, with 8 automakers being summoned for talks, 3 investigated for violations, and 2 withdrawing disputed upgrade packages while promising to restore performance. Subsequently, an AI-related post listed the names of the 8 automakers.
When contacted today for verification, BYD, Tesla, XPeng, Li Auto, NIO, Seres AITO, Zeekr (Geely), and GAC Aion all denied the claims. BYD, Tesla, XPeng, Li Auto, and GAC Aion have explicitly refuted the allegations. A Tesla representative stated that the company has not been summoned by regulators over battery locking issues, and all software updates undergo rigorous testing and filing. XPeng's legal department issued a statement saying: "After verification, our company has not recently received any so-called 'summons' mentioned in this false information, nor are we under investigation." Li Auto also denied the claims, stating that the company has not been summoned by regulators over battery locking issues. BYD officially stated: "Recently, rumors about BYD being 'summoned and investigated' have appeared online. These claims are completely false and baseless." GAC Aion also issued an official statement: "GAC Aion has never been summoned by relevant authorities over matters mentioned in this false information, nor is the company included in any list of enterprises under investigation." (Yicai)
